What are the main characters in 'Half of a Yellow Sun' full story?

1 answer
2024-12-13 11:47

In the 'Half of a Yellow Sun' full story, Olanna is a central character. She is from a well - to - do background and is involved in a relationship. Ugwu is her servant who has his own dreams and development in the story. Kainene, Olanna's sister, is a strong - willed woman, and Richard, a white man with a connection to the Nigerian situation through his relationship with Kainene, are among the main characters.

Can you summarize the full story of 'Half of a Yellow Sun'?

1 answer
2024-12-13 07:02

Well, 'Half of a Yellow Sun' tells a complex story. It portrays the impact of the Nigerian Civil War on individuals. For instance, Olanna has to face the destruction of her relationship and her world as the war progresses. Ugwu, on the other hand, evolves from a naive boy to someone who has seen the worst of humanity. The story uses their perspectives to show the broader picture of the war, including the political and social upheaval.

Analysis of 'yellow wallpaper short story'

1 answer
2024-12-12 17:12

The 'Yellow Wallpaper' is a short story that shows the oppression of women in a patriarchal society. The narrator's descent into madness can be seen as a reaction to her confinement and lack of agency. For example, her husband, a doctor, prescribes rest cure which actually restricts her freedom.

Analysis of 'A Yellow Wallpaper' short story

1 answer
2024-12-05 00:03

The short story 'A Yellow Wallpaper' is a remarkable piece of literature. It delves into themes of mental illness, gender roles, and the power of the imagination. The woman in the story is isolated in a room with the yellow wallpaper, and as she stares at it more and more, she begins to hallucinate. This could be seen as a form of rebellion against the constraints placed on her. The story makes the reader question the traditional understanding of sanity and insanity, especially when it comes to how women were treated in that era.
